Taro Logo

.NET Developer

Medblocks builds a developer-focused stack for healthcare that enables direct integration with clinical workflows using open standards.
Backend
Mid-Level Software Engineer
In-Person
Healthcare

Description For .NET Developer

Medblocks is revolutionizing healthcare technology by building a developer-focused "stack for healthcare" that enables seamless integration with clinical workflows. Founded by doctors-turned-programmers, the company leverages open standards like openEHR, FHIR, SMART, and SNOMED CT to make healthcare data accessible and interoperable.

As a .NET Developer at Medblocks, you'll be instrumental in developing and maintaining core applications within the Medblocks platform. The role involves designing and implementing scalable applications using ASP.NET Core and C#, creating RESTful APIs, and working with SQL Server databases. You'll collaborate with cross-functional teams to build solutions that directly impact healthcare professionals and patient outcomes.

The company culture is built on three core values: Trust (with no micromanagement), Transparency (including shared company financials), and Customer Value & Honesty. They operate as a remote-first team that values deep work and continuous learning. The position offers competitive compensation, flexible working hours, and the opportunity to make a meaningful impact in healthcare technology.

The ideal candidate should have strong expertise in .NET development, database technologies, and modern software development practices. They value problem-solvers who can think from first principles, communicate effectively, and are passionate about creating technology that makes a difference in healthcare. Additional experience with healthcare standards (FHIR, openEHR) and cloud services is a plus.

Last updated 14 days ago

Responsibilities For .NET Developer

  • Designing and implementing scalable applications using ASP.NET Core, C#, and related technologies
  • Creating and consuming RESTful APIs and working with various database technologies
  • Writing clean, maintainable, and efficient code
  • Collaborating with front-end developers to integrate user-facing elements with server-side logic
  • Participating in code reviews and providing constructive feedback to peers
  • Troubleshooting and debugging applications to ensure optimal performance
  • Contributing to architecture discussions and design patterns
  • Staying abreast of emerging technologies and sharing knowledge with the team

Requirements For .NET Developer

  • Bachelor's degree in Computer Science, Engineering, or related field (or equivalent professional experience)
  • Proficiency in C# and .NET Core framework, with experience creating web applications and services
  • Strong knowledge of RESTful API design and development
  • Experience with database technologies, particularly SQL Server
  • Understanding of modern software development best practices
  • Familiarity with front-end technologies such as HTML, CSS, and JavaScript frameworks
  • Experience with unit testing and automated testing frameworks
  • Excellent problem-solving and debugging skills
  • Ability to work collaboratively in a remote-first environment

Benefits For .NET Developer

  • Competitive salary
  • Flexible, remote-first work environment
  • Autonomy to manage your own working hours
  • Transparent company financials and metrics
  • Regular opportunities to grow and learn new skills
  • Work directly with the founders
  • Make a meaningful impact on healthcare
  • Travel opportunities for team meet-ups and conferences
  • Liberal leave policy with no micromanagement

Interested in this job?

Jobs Related To Medblocks .NET Developer